John Parsons is one of New Zealand's leading cyber-safety consultants in schools. He is holding a cyber-safety evening for parents of Intermediate School students on Thursday, 26th May at 7pm 

Entry is free

Venue: Chisnallwood Intermediate School, 7pm - 8.30pm

This is a must for parents of 11-13yr old students. 

You can read more about John here.

Topics covered include:

  • Identifies the specific challenges children face when using ICT
  • Workshop informs parents and gives them the tools to support their children in how to use ICT safely and ethically at home and at school
  • Includes guidance on behaviour management processes for parents in the practical situations they will face

This workshop empowers parents to take responsibility for safeguarding their children.
